The family medicine outpatient clinic in Nedaivoda village, within the Hleiuvate territorial community, is nearing the end of its reconstruction. The Metinvest Group supported the upgrading of the medical facility's surrounding area. Once the essential equipment is bought and set up, the clinic will provide services to roughly 1,400 residents from three local areas.
During the reconstruction, the clinic underwent a complete replacement of the heating and water supply systems, installation of a new diesel generator to ensure uninterrupted operation during power outages, and construction of a modular boiler house. The medical facility also received new windows, insulated façades, and a renovated roof. The renovation works were carried out at the initiative of the deputies of the Hleiuvate community.
Metinvest also joined this important project to support the medical facility. With the company’s funding, new curbstones were installed, access roads and parking areas were asphalted, handrails were added, and anti-slip stairs were built to ensure a comfortable and safe entrance to the clinic. In addition, to provide barrier-free access, an elevator to the shelter is planned for people with disabilities, the elderly, parents with strollers, and other groups with limited mobility.
